Fair pay for NHS staff to end the strikes and prevent more unnecessary deaths.

Rejected 21 signatures

What the petition asks

Please accept the fair pay rises requested by NHS staff so that the workers can provide a safer healthcare system and save lives.

NHS staff chose this job to help people and save lives - stop taking that away from them.
The NHS is crumbling due to insufficient funding, unfair pay and substandard working conditions for its staff. This has resulted in severe staff shortages due to poor retention which has led to unnecessary deaths of citizens. Staff continue to feel burnt out from constantly working over-time due to the shortages. Paramedics are unable to reach people in time to save lives. Tax-paying people who would like to fund the NHS are dying outside of hospitals due to staff shortages. This has to stop.
